Riley Marine Products

Address
840 W Esther St,
Long Beach,
CA, 90813
USA
ZIP Code 90813
Phone (562) 435-5233
Fax (562) 435-6512
Categories Welding
Website N/A
Twitter N/A
Facebook N/A